    Exclusive: How Nnamdi Kanu was arrested, bundled to Nigeria – Reno Omokri spills

    According to former presidential spokesperson, Reno Omokri, leader of the proscribed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B), Nnamdi Kanu was not arrested in the United Kingdom (UK) as reported by the Federal Government of Nigeria.


    The Attorney-General of the Federation and Minister of Justice, Mr. Abubakar Malami (SAN) had disclosed that Kanu was arrested and brought back to Nigeria on Sunday.


    He said the arrest followed a collaborative effort between security agencies in Nigeria and Interpol.


    However, Reno Omokri has claimed otherwise, according to him, Kalu was arrested in Kenya and it was an illegal intention.


    Taking to his verified Instagram handle, Reno revealed further, “I just spoke with a top UK government source. Nnamdi Kanu was NOT arrested or extradited by the British. According to this official, Kanu was “almost definitely arrested in KENYA” and “it was an illegal detention”. I won’t reveal my source, but I have him on record. 
    For those who do not know how these things operate, the United Kingdom is a civilised nation that is governed by the Rule of Law. No one, no matter how wanted, can be arrested and extradited without extradition hearings before a court, especially when that person is a British citizen. 
    There are Nigerians who are currently fighting their extradition to Nigeria in court in the UK. They cannot leave the UK on their own volition or on the request of the Nigerian government until their hearings are exhausted. If they lose at the court of first instance, they have a right of appeal. 
    I repeat, Nnamdi Kanu was not arrested or extradited by the British government. 
    Also, it is a lie that he boarded a plane and came to Nigeria by himself. That is just propaganda.” 


    Kanu faces trial on charges bordering on terrorism, treasonable felony, unlawful possession of firearms and management of an unlawful society.
